Narrative

Employee was using a cheater pipe and wrench to tighten bolts on dozer tracks. The pipe slipped & employee began experiencing pain in his neck the next day. He was sent to the doctor for examination when the pain he was experiencing was made known to the plant manager. Just was diagnosed as needing surgery, thus the delay in reporting.
